A Unique Perspective on American Art
Henry Adams brings readers closer to the dynamic between two contrasting personalities. Benton, the established artist, guided Pollock, the experimental visionary. Through detailed storytelling and vivid examples, Adams captures their journey. This book celebrates how differences can spark innovation.
